Frequently Asked Questions
What is the capacitance and voltage rating of the Panasonic ECA1HM220?
The ECA1HM220 provides 22 µF of capacitance at a rated voltage of 50 V. This combination is well suited for power-supply decoupling and bulk energy storage in circuits operating from 12 V to 48 V rails, providing adequate voltage headroom while maintaining a compact 5 mm diameter radial footprint on the PCB.
How low is the leakage current of the ECA1HM220, and why does it matter for precision circuits?
The ECA1HM220 specifies a maximum leakage current of 0.011 mA, which is very low for a 22 µF aluminum electrolytic capacitor. In precision analog circuits, timer networks, or sample-and-hold stages, excessive leakage can cause voltage drift and measurement errors, so a 0.011 mA maximum helps preserve signal integrity and long charge retention.

For a 48 V industrial power supply design, how does the ECA1HM220 compare to a higher-voltage 63 V variant?
At a 48 V rail, the ECA1HM220 rated at 50 V leaves only a small 2 V headroom, which is insufficient when accounting for transient spikes common in industrial switching supplies. A 63 V-rated variant would provide at least a 15 V margin above the 48 V rail, substantially reducing the risk of capacitor overvoltage failure and improving long-term reliability in those applications.
